1. Height Adjustability

One of the most critical features to look for in a laptop stand is height adjustability. The stand should allow you to position the laptop screen at eye level to avoid straining your neck and shoulders. An adjustable stand enables you to customize the height according to your seating position and personal preference, promoting a more comfortable and ergonomic setup. Popular options include the Rain Design mStand , which offers multiple height settings, and the Roost Laptop Stand, known for its portable adjustable design.

2. Sturdiness and Stability

A stable and sturdy laptop stand is essential to ensure the safety of your device and maintain a secure working environment. Look for stands made from durable materials such as aluminum or steel, with a design that can support the weight of your laptop without wobbling or tipping over. The Nulaxy Laptop Stand, for example, features a solid aluminum frame that can hold up to 15 lb, making it a reliable choice for most notebooks.

3. Ventilation and Cooling

Laptops can generate heat during prolonged use, leading to discomfort and affecting performance. Opt for a laptop stand with ventilation holes or a built-in cooling fan to facilitate airflow and dissipate heat effectively. The Cooler Master NotepAD Ventilator integrates dual fans and raised platform design, helping to keep your device cool while you work.

4. Portable and Storage‑Friendly

If you frequently work in different locations or prefer a clutter‑free workspace, consider the portability and storage options of the laptop stand. Look for a foldable or compact stand that is easy to transport and store when not in use. The MOFT Invisible Laptop Stand adheres directly to the bottom of your laptop and folds flat, making it ideal for on‑the‑go professionals and students.

5. Cable Management

An organized workspace contributes to ergonomic comfort and productivity. Choose a laptop stand with integrated cable management features to keep your workspace tidy and cables neatly arranged. The VIVO Desk Cable Management Tray can be attached to many stand models, helping you route power and peripheral cables away from your work surface.

6. Compatibility with Laptop Size

Ensure that the laptop stand you choose is compatible with the size and weight of your laptop. Some stands are designed for specific laptop sizes, while others offer adjustable widths to accommodate various devices. Check the maximum weight capacity of the stand to ensure it can support your laptop securely. The Ergotron WorkFit--T Sit‑Stand Desktop Converter provides a wide platform and adjustable clamps, fitting laptops from 11 in to 17 in comfortably.

7. Additional Features

Consider any additional features that may enhance your user experience, such as extra USB ports, adjustable angles, or a built‑in keyboard tray. These features can add versatility and convenience to your setup, allowing you to customize your workstation according to your specific needs and preferences. For instance, the Satechi Aluminum Laptop Stand with USB‑C Hub combines a sleek stand with integrated USB‑C connectivity, reducing the need for separate adapters.
